We’re back with another AFTN Soccer Show packed full of Vancouver Whitecaps, MLS, Canadian national team, and Canadian Premier League chat.
The Whitecaps have a bye week for some much needed rest in the middle of their grueling seven-game road spell. They head into it after being crowned Cascadian Cup champions and bolstering their playoff push with a good road point at NYCFC. We delve into that match, the inadequacy of Yankee Stadium for soccer, and look at the lie of the land for the 'Caps in their battle for a postseason place.
We also chat about the initial impact Messi has had on the league both on the pitch and media landscape off it, and ponder whether the growing Saudi league will impact MLS and whether South American teams are wanting a piece of the North American pie.
Our feature interview this episode is with returning Whitecaps star Sam Adekugbe. We chat with some about his return to Vancouver, his hopes for the team, his club career in-between the 'Caps, and some Canadian national team highs, from his jump into a snowbank to his first goal for his country and, of course, playing in his first World Cup. We also chat about the departure of John Herdman, what's next for Canada, and the off-field battles with Canada Soccer.
Plus we chat about the week in the Canadian Premier League, as Vancouver FC lose again, the battle for the five playoff places heats up, and the plan to bring the CPL to Saskatchewan falters, for now. All of this plus Fontaines D.C. begin their residency as our Artists of the Month.
